
World Heritage Charity Art Exhibition 40th Anniversary of the World Heritage Convention
PIECE OF PEACE - World Heritage Exhibition PART-3-
To celebrate the 40th anniversary of the adoption of the World Heritage Convention, "PIECE OF PEACE" World Heritage Exhibition PART-3 made by "Lego® Block" will be held.
This exhibition is a charity art exhibition created by Lego® blocks, a toy that is loved around the world, "World Heritage", an irreplaceable earth treasure.
In addition to "Pyramids", "Angkor", "Monsanmichel", "Cultural Property of Ancient Kyoto", "Sagrada Familia", "Vienna Historic District", "Sydney Opera House", "Nikko Toshogu Shrine", "Architecture, Gardens and Archaeological Sites representing Hiraizumi and Bukkokudo" will be exhibited.World Heritage
In addition, works by 40 artists from Japan and abroad, messages from cultural figures, images of the earth seen from space, etc. are also exhibited, and this exhibition allows you to enjoy the earth.
